Historical Context of copyright Legislation
The roots of copyright legislation can be traced back to the early 20th century when the number of cars on the roadway began to increase drastically. The introduction of the vehicle raised issues about safety, liability, and environmental impact. As an action, governments around the globe began implementing policies governing drivers and automobiles.
Key Milestones in copyright Legislation:
- Early 1900s: The first driving licenses appeared, typically needing drivers to pass a basic assessment.
- 1920s: Many Western countries started formalizing their licensing procedures, including age constraints and knowledge tests.
- 1950s-60s: The execution of road safety campaigns highlighted the importance of driving education.
- 1980s: Introduction of automated screening and digital licensing to enhance accessibility and efficiency.
- 2000s-Present: Ongoing reforms addressing issues such as roadway safety, impaired driving, and the integration of digital recognition technologies.
The Structure of copyright Legislation
copyright legislation is multifaceted, including a variety of guidelines that govern the issuance, validity, and enforcement of driving licenses. The following table lays out the essential parts of copyright laws:
Component | Description |
---|---|
Eligibility | Minimum age, residency requirements, and citizen status. |
Testing Requirements | Knowledge examinations, useful driving tests, and vision screening. |
Licensing Types | Various classes for numerous lorry types (e.g., motorcycles, trucks). |
Renewal and Expiration | Regulations on license renewal frequency and expiration dates. |
Charges | Fines, demerit points, and suspension for offenses. |
Kinds Of Driving Licenses
Driving licenses are classified based upon the type of car the holder is allowed to operate. Understanding these classifications is crucial for compliance with the law.
Typical Types of Driving Licenses:
- Class A: Required for operating heavy trucks and automobiles over a particular weight.
- Class B: For larger traveler lorries, such as buses and vans.
- Class C: Standard licenses for individual automobiles.
- Class M: Motorcycles, requiring specialized screening.
- Learner's Permit: Allows individuals to practice driving under supervision.
Current Trends in copyright Legislation
As society evolves, so do the laws governing driving licenses. Current trends and changes in legislation show improvements in technology and shifts in public attitudes toward mobility and safety.
Key Trends:
- Digital Licenses: With the increase of digital innovation, numerous jurisdictions are moving towards the adoption of digital driving licenses that can be stored on smart devices.
- Automatic Renewals: Some regions now permit for automated license renewals based on electronic records, minimizing the need for in-person visits.
- Increased Focus on Safety: Many countries are tightening policies related to impaired driving, distracted driving, and roadway safety to combat increasing mishap rates.
- Ecologically Friendly Policies: With growing concerns over climate modification, some places have actually introduced rewards for electrical lorry ownership, impacting copyright classifications.
Frequently Asked Questions About copyright Legislation
What is the minimum age to acquire a copyright?
- The minimum age varies by jurisdiction however normally varies from 16 to 18 years.
What documents are required to get a copyright?
- Common requirements consist of evidence of identity, residency, and, in some cases, completion of a chauffeur's education course.
What takes place if a copyright is ended?
- Driving with an expired license can result in fines, and the individual may require to retake tests depending on for how long the license has actually been expired.
Can a copyright be revoked?
- Yes, licenses can be revoked for extreme offenses such as repeated DUI offenses, reckless driving, or building up a lot of demerit points.
Exist driving licenses for electric automobiles?
- While electrical lorries do not require a particular license type, operators should hold a standard copyright appropriate for their automobile class.
